About this school
Mendon Elementary School is
a rural public school
in Ruffs Dale, Pennsylvania that is part of Yough School District.
It serves 234 students
in grades K - 4 with a student/teacher ratio of 13.8:1.
Its teachers have had 213 projects funded on Ðǿմ«Ã½.
